As far as service work goes, I've had some warranty work done there which has been okay but there was one experience with one of my E39s that really rubbed me the wrong way. I took the car in with a catalyst low efficiency code. I had replaced the catalyst and rear oxygen sensors prior to admitting defeat and taking it in to BMW London. Their service tech working on my car sunk several billable hours into the car and determined I needed to replace the already new o2 sensors in the rear at $300+ a pop or they would not continue to work on the car. The oxygen sensors I had just installed were confirmed working via scan data before I took the car in but rather than eat several hours of diagnostic work and still have a malfunctioning car, I just agreed to their outrageously priced parts and demanded my old sensors back. Well, the new sensors did not fix the issue (surprise!) and the techs had to actually figure out what the problem was which meant more diagnostic costs. At the end of the day it was a chafed wire, which should have cost pennies to fix should the tech have actually used some diagnostic skills, but being strong armed into buying overly expensive parts I knew I didn't need and then not getting my old parts back just made me furious. From that moment on I've not brought any of my BMWs to BMW London for service beyond no cost to me warranty work.
